Follicular Unit Extraction (FUE) is one of two primary methods of hair-transplantation currently offered; the other is the older and more invasive strip-harvesting (often cited as "F.U.T."). While F.U.E. is newer and less invasive than F.U.T., it is typically twice the cost, as well. Additionally, it is reasoned that F.U.E. has a lower ultimate yield of follicular units than F.U.T., making it unfavorable for patients who require extensive work however it is also reasoned that the skill of the surgeon is a major factor in the ultimate yield of the follicular units and that a skilled surgeon can get the same yield as one would get in a F.U.T. procedure. Though it is often claimed that F.U.E leaves no scars while F.U.T. leaves a thin scar in the donor area, F.U.E. does indeed cause scarring, though it is of a "pit" (circular) nature rather than a linear one and is often hard to detect when the extraction is done by a skilled surgeon unlike a F.U.T. procedure where one can not wear the hair very short without the strip scar becoming visible.
